LIFE IN ALL ITS INNOCENCE … and vulnerability
A baby snowshoe hare spotted on my run today – and a beautiful day it was, the kind that makes your heart smile and ache simultaneously. The air smelled like wild honey, the sky was indigo at the far edges of space, the lakes still as glass. I saw a peregrine falcon, a little bunny, a skittish mole snake. I saw nudies basking like seals on a wooden floe under a balmy sun, paragliders soaring up high on thermals, children laughing and dogs chasing balls. And I came home to learn my uncle had been killed in a car accident.
Sometimes life has a way of knocking your legs out from under you.
Remember to cherish those close to you. While you can.
May your soul soar Oom Hans. May you rest in peace.
